Moras - Pindwara, Sirohi

Moras is a village situated in the Pindwara tehsil of Sirohi district, Rajasthan. It is located approximately 17 km from the tehsil headquarters in Pindwara and around 42 km from the district headquarters in Sirohi. Moras village is a designated Gram Panchayat.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Moras is 090118. The village covers a total geographical area of 1965.23 hectares and falls under the 307022 pincode. Pindwara is the nearest town, located about 17 km away.

Moras village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.

Population of Moras

According to the 2011 Census, Moras village had a total population of 4,525 people, including 2,244 males and 2,281 females, living in 810 households. The sex ratio was 1,016 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 28.14%, with male literacy at 38.38% and female literacy at 18.26%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 5, while the Scheduled Tribe (ST) population was 4,511.

Transport and Connectivity of Moras

Moras is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Banas, while the nearest airport is Maharana Pratap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 67.5 km.

In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Pindwara to Moras is about 17 km, with a usual travel time of around 30-60 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Sirohi to Moras is about 42 km, with the usual travel time around ~1.2 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
